What is the California Birth Certificate Application?
The California Birth Certificate Application is a crucial form for obtaining certified copies of birth records in California, specifically for residents of San Joaquin County. This form provides a means for individuals to request both authorized and informational certified copies. Authorized copies are essential for identification purposes, while informational copies serve as personal records without legal identification capabilities.
Applying for an authorized copy requires notarization to verify the identity of the requester, ensuring the security and authenticity of the documents involved in vital records.

Eligibility Criteria for the California Birth Certificate Application
Eligibility to apply for a birth certificate generally includes parents, guardians, or individuals with a legal interest in the records. Understanding the distinctions between authorized and informational copies is essential; authorized copies require specific identification and notarization, while informational copies have fewer restrictions.
It is crucial to familiarize yourself with the notarization requirements, as failure to comply can affect the application process based on the applicant’s relationship to the individual named on the birth certificate.

What is the difference between an authorized and informational certified copy?
An authorized certified copy can be used to establish identity for legal purposes, while an informational certified copy cannot be used as a primary form of identification. Choose wisely based on your needs.
